The fibular collateral ligament, also known as the lateral collateral ligament, provides lateral stability to the knee by resisting hyperextension or rotation of the extended knee joint.

The structure that provides lateral stability to the knee, also referred to as the lateral collateral ligament, is the fibular collateral ligament. This extrinsic ligament of the knee joint spans from the lateral epicondyle of the femur to the head of the fibula. It is crucial in stabilizing the knee by resisting hyperextension or rotation of the extended knee joint. In conjunction with other ligaments like the cruciate ligaments and the menisci, it contributes to the overall function and integrity of the knee joint.
